  The Subcommittee on Health of the Committee on Energy and Commerce will hold a hearing on Thursday, March 25, 2026, at 2 p.m. (EDT) in the John D. Dingell Room, 2123 Rayburn House Office Building.  The hearing is entitled “Policies to Protect Our Communities From Illicit Drug Threats.”

Legislation 

  • H.R. 1266the Combatting Illicit Xylazine Act
  • H.R. 5630, To amend the Public Health Service Act to require additional information in State plans for Substance Use Prevention, Treatment, and Recovery Services block grants
  • H.R. 5629, To provide that the final rule of the Department of Health and Human Services titled “Medications for the Treatment of Opioid Use Disorder”, except for the portion of the final rule relating to accreditation of opioid treatment programs, shall have no force or effect.
  • H.R. 2004, Tyler’s Law
  • H.R. 7970the STOP Nitazenes Act
  • H.R. 8000the END 7-OH Act
  • H.R. 7184the PRESS Act
  • H.R. 8005the Stop Pills That Kill Act
  • H.R. 5880the Fight Illicit Pill Presses Act
  • H.R. 1227the Alternatives to Pain Act
  • H.R. 2715the Destruction of Hazardous Imports Act
  • H.R. 1561the ALERT Communities Act
  • H.R. 7994the HERO Act
  • H.R. 7407the Prohibiting Tianeptine and Other Dangerous Products Act of 2026
